January 5th, 2010: State dropped all charges againt client

On October 20th, our client was arrested by the Palm Beach County Sheriff's deputy and charged with two counts: 1) Aggravated Battery (using a deadly weapon), and 2) Child Abuse.  After two weeks of discussions between our office and the State Attorney's Office the felony charges were dropped and one count of Simple Battery filed. 

 

Our office did not waive speedy trial.  Thus, the case must be tried before the deadline of January, 20th,  2010.  With that date fast approaching, the State dropped the remaining charge against our client on January 5th, 2010.
